See Metallica Play "Metal Militia" for First Time in 6 Years

'Kill 'Em All' classic resurfaced during encore at Pinkpop

Metallica's "Metal Militia" is a formative early thrash classic, a call to arms for the headbanging true believers to rally together and spread the faith. As awesome as it is, the band hadn't played the Kill 'Em All standout for a while — six long years, to be exact.

That drought ended on June 17th, when the Four Horsemen hit the Pinkpop festival in Landgraaf, Netherlands, and kicked off their encore with, you guessed it, "Metal Militia." The performance marked the first time Metallica had broken out the cut since a December 15th, 2016 show at Los Angeles' Fonda Theatre. Even better, there wasn't a spot of rust to be seen.
